Charles and Ray Eames developed this model in connection with the »Low Cost Furniture« competition held by the Museum of Modern Art in New York and for the Herman Miller company, who produced various versions of the chair between 1951 and 1967. <br/><br/>As with their plastic chairs, the seats and backs are again modeled on the human body. In the case of DKR, however, the result is a comfortable organic form even though such a hard and cold material as steel wire is used. Manufactured on an industrial scale, it proved possible to sell the chair successfully at a relatively low price. In 1952, the design won the Trail Blazer Award given by the Home Fashions League in the United States.

The Planck collection, designed by Piero Lissoni for B&B Italia, features three elegantly crafted round tables that share a unified design language yet each possesses its own distinct character. These tables are characterized by their gracefully tapered, truncated cone structure, which widens subtly from the top to the base, exuding a refined aesthetic. The tabletops are made of semi-transparent glass, while the lacquered bases are available in a variety of satin, glossy, or sophisticated rosewood-effect finishes. The collection includes three sizes: a large 120 cm diameter coffee table, a medium 80 cm version, and a compact 50 cm service table, which features a unique backlit top. The integrated LED lighting can be customized via a dedicated app, allowing users to adjust the intensity and warmth of the light to create a versatile ambiance. *This fixed-size sofa and armchair features a sturdy 30x30 mm tubular steel frame with an epoxy powder coating in RAL-K7 8025, supported by coated rubber elastic straps for optimal resilience. The seating is padded with high-density polyurethane foam, layered over a polyamide velveteen backing and topped with a protective felt pad, while the 10 mm HPL panel—veneered and edged in Canaletto walnut "rigatino" with a water-based acrylic finish—adds refined durability. The armrests are crafted from double-panelled poplar and pine, upholstered with differentiated density foam and covered in prewashed, sterilized goose down stitched into compartments for superior comfort. The backrest, built with 20x20 mm tubular steel and elastic straps, mirrors this premium padding and is available in a fixed version or with an adjustable headrest (up to 82 cm). The seat cushion follows the same luxurious construction, and all upholstery—available in fabric or leather—is fully removable via zippers and Velcro fastenings. With a seat depth of 63 cm, the design rests on a 25mm-diameter steel bracket (21 cm high, gunmetal grey epoxy coating) and features interchangeable PVC or felt feet for floor adaptability. Winner of the Golden Compass in 1994, the Mobil chest of drawers is presented in a matt version in white, black, green, plum and light blue. The new edition is made of recycled industrial materials, and has the same robust construction and functionality as the original. The basic element of the system is the drawer, alternated with shelves and tops, connected by an aluminium structure. In this new finish, the structure is coloured and the wheels are coloured too, now black instead of grey. The bookcase Hemingway with its refined and strong shapes was created by architect Massimo Castagna. It is a bookcase with frame in solid wood, made of uprights and beams, wall or ceiling fixing. The uprights are made lighter by frontal and lateral fissures and are characterised by inserts in polished metal. The horizontal beams physically and visually define the shape and rhythm of this bookcase. The structure supports the shelves and storage units available in different functions and dimensions. The bookcase Hemingway can accommodate horizontal storage units with flap opening and vertical units with hinge door, made of glass and wood. It also has a wooden desk top. The glass shelves and their peculiar side slots, are fixed to the uprights through interlocking pins, each shelf is provided with fall arrest security system. Vertical uprights and horizontal beams in solid wood complete the structure and are available in Siberian Ash or Eucalipto, with inserts and supports in polished chrome or gold. The shelves are in extra clear or smoked glass and the feet are height adjustable. Standard heights are 260 and 300cm, also available in custom size, and Tonelli Design proposes shelves in standard size 60 and 100cm.
